Part 1 is of the new beautiful Cresco going on a test flight from Pacific Aerospace manufacturing center at Hamilton airport, up to Huntly and back again.

Heres why I just love this new scenery;
-TEXTURES, incredible, I reckon the runway textures are 10x more sharper, crisper, clearer than the ORBX Brisbane new 7cm airport, and it comes without the huge FPS hit!
-CLUTTER, I love seeing all the custom modeled cars and airport vehicles, the burning drum, cows, tractors, hay bales...all the little things that make it so much more realistic.
-CUSTOM MODELS, All the major buildings in the area are modelled like in the CBD, Fonterra factory, Mystery Creek events centre, Huntly Power Station...etc etc....they're everywhere
-AUTOGEN! Awesome , I love cranking up the autogen, wasn't dissapointed!
-INTERIOR terminal and Control tower modeled, now with the invention of BOB (coming up in Part 2 and 3) its really interesting walking around inside, and especially with terminals with large windows like Hamilton.
